Business & Hotel Management School (BHMS) is a private business & hospitality school in Lucerne, Switzerland established in 1998.[3]

Founded as a branch of the Bénédict Schools, this education group has 8 campuses in Switzerland (in St. Gallen, Zurich, Lucerne and Bern[4][5]) and over 15,000 students and professionals studying at its premises every year.

B.H.M.S. School provides undergraduate and postgraduate programs in the fields of Hotel Management, Culinary Arts,[6] and Global Business.[7][8]

History[edit]

1998 - BHMS was founded as a branch of Bénédict School, in Switzerland. Opening of BHMS Baselstrasse Campus.

2003 - Recognition of awards from Brighton University.

2007 - Collaborative agreement developed with Robert Gordon University.

2008 - First validation event to offer a Robert Gordon University program at B.H.M.S. Introduction of the first bachelor's degree in Hotel & Hospitality Management. Opening of BHMS Lakefront Centre Campus. BHMS receives the full accreditation by the ACFF (American Culinary Federation Foundation).

2009-2019 2-year MBA Program offered in partnership with CityU of Seattle in 2 specialization areas: Hospitality Management and Global Management.

2011/2012 - Opening of BHMS St. Karli Quai Campus. Opening of BHMS Sentipark Campus.

2015 - Inauguration of a new BHMS Culinary Lab in Lucerne. Introduction of the new MSc in International Hospitality Business Management (RGU).

2015 - Validation of the Graduate Certificate in International Hospitality Business Management.

2016 - Validation of the Bachelor of Arts in Culinary Arts and first cohort of culinary students.

2016 - Introduction of the short-term Summer/Winter Courses. Introduction of the HF- Dipl. Hotelier Restaurateur program in German language. Opening of the BHMS 'City Campus' in Lucerne.

2018 - Appointment of BHMS Director Beat Wicki.

2018 - Introduction of the new BHMS MBA Degrees in 3 specializations.

2018 - Introduction of the new MSc in Global Business Management (RGU).

2021 - Appointment of BHMS COO/Director Michael G. Wagenthaler.

Accreditation & memberships[edit]

  • Member of EURHODIP - The Leading Hotel Schools in Europe;[9]
  • Member of the International Council on Hotel, Restaurant and Institutional Education (I-CHRIE);[10]
  • Member of the American Hotel & Lodging Association;[11]
  • Its Culinary program is accredited by the Accrediting Commission of the American Culinary Federation Foundation.[12]

Campuses[edit]

B.H.M.S. has 4 campuses located in the center of Lucerne city within a 5–15 minute walking distance from each other:[1]

  • City Campus (the main student residence)
  • Lakeside Campus (classrooms, culinary labs, and student residence
  • Sentipark (classrooms and academic offices)
  • St. Karli-Quai (classrooms).[14]
